Orthofix Says Moody's And S&P Improve Their Outlooks To Stable From Negative - Quick Facts

Orthofix International N.V. (OFIX) announced that both Standard & Poor's Rating Services and Moody's Investor Services have improved their outlooks for the Company from negative to stable.

The company said that Moody's Investor Services revised its outlook on 18th November 2009, citing "improvement in the spine implant business, which has contributed to margin expansion and improved free cash flow."

Earlier this month Standard & Poor's Rating Service also revised its outlook, noting "recent improvements in the company's operating performance and debt reduction," the company said.
